Role & Responsibilities

  • Oversee the inventory management of jewelry and packaging, including planning and executing biannual inventory checks across all Pomellato Japan locations.
  • Collect, analyze, and report inventory data to the Operations Senior Manager and Finance team.
  • Manage logistics and repair coordination by liaising with outsourcing warehouses and repair vendors to ensure seamless operations.
  • Coordinate international and domestic shipping, including preparing shipping documentation and assisting with customs clearance.
  • Supervise quality control processes and assist in managing vendor contracts and processing invoices.
  • Maintain and update data in Salesforce and other relevant systems, ensuring accuracy and efficiency.
  • Act as a point of contact for store staff regarding shipment status, repair updates, and operational issues.
  • Gather feedback and propose improvements to workflow and service quality.

Qualifications

  • Minimum 3 years of experience in logistics, operations, or supply chain coordination, preferably in the retail industry.
  • Business-level proficiency in Japanese and English; Italian is a plus.
